General guidelines for computerized medical information system on patient care: Examples of some state and university hospitals in Turkey

Abstract :Computerized Hospital Management Information Systems that have been in use in Turkey contain information on all patients admitted to inpatient or outpatient units of the hospitals. Among the data are the routine demographic information, history of prior therapy, illness history, physical examination findings, laboratory results such as hematology and clinical chemistry, serology, virology, bacteriology, Immunology, urine analysis, parasitology, blood gas analysis data, and the reports of anatomical and surgical pathology, roentgen, ultrasonagraphy, tomography, endoscopy, bronchoscopy, EEG, and surgery, patient discharge summaries and billing charges.Keywords : Hospital Information System, Computerized Medical Records
